Abstract
The control mechanisms of flow processes in process control systems were considered. The task of developing mechanisms for control of the structure of flow processes on the basis of logic modeling was stated. Event models of the plant and processes in the flow technology were proposed. Interaction of the proposed model with the traditional components of process control systems was defined. Potentialities of the proposed models for the process control systems and other related production systems were discussed.
